What are I-beams?
I-beam is used as a structural element, it can be recognized by its characteristic cross-section resembling the letter “I”. I-beam consists of two parallel flanges (top and bottom), which are connected by a vertical web. This specific shape means that the production of beams does not consume much material, and in addition, the individual elements of the I-beam are extremely resistant to bending.
I-beams are commonly used in both residential and industrial construction. They are used as load-bearing elements of roofs, ceilings, walls, bridges, as well as in skyscrapers and other structures that must withstand significant loads. I-beams are also used as roof structure elements, columns and wall reinforcements.
What are the advantages of using I-beams in modern construction?
- High strength with low dead weight
One of the most important advantages of I-beams is their exceptional load resistance with a relatively low dead weight. The specific design of the beams allows for even weight distribution. In practice, this means that I-beams can be used in structures requiring large spans, such as industrial halls or bridges. The lower dead weight reduces the load on the foundations and thus translates into savings at this stage of construction.
- Material savings
I-Beams are designed in such a way that only small amounts of raw materials are used to produce them. The web is made of OSB wood-based board, while the lower and upper shelves are made of structural wood. The use of I-Beams shortens the time needed to build a house or industrial hall.
- Durability
I-Beams are characterized by high resistance to mechanical loads. For this reason, I-Beams are perfect as rafters, girders and load-bearing elements in single- and multi-family buildings. Additional protective coatings can be used to protect the wood, e.g. against moisture and increase its durability.
- Excellent acoustic and thermal parameters
I-beams not only have a positive effect on the durability of buildings, but also insulate interiors against heat loss and noise. I-beams I-Beams allow for minimizing the transfer of vibrations and sounds through the structure. These elements improve the energy efficiency of buildings and reduce heat loss, which is why they are often used to build modern and ecological houses.
